Here is Mohamed's story in his own words.

'My Father Fuad, he is 73, my mother Mona, she is 59. I have 4 sisters, the other one is Suha 30 years old, and her daughter Zeina is 5 years old, the second is Batool 29 years old, the third is Ola 27 years old and her son Nasser, the youngest is Nairman who is 20 years old.

We had a peaceful life, our house was full of love. It was bewitching, contained of 3 floors and a garden in front of it at Bureij camp in the middle area.

We left our home and directed to Rafah city to find a safe place. The Israeli military have destroyed our whole neighbourhood including our house and levelled in the ground.

My father, who is over seventy years old, spent all his savings and retirement money to build that house. Now we are displaced and homeless.

I used to go to my work in Gaza, in addition to seeing my friends either in one of the cafes or on it's picturesque seashore. The occupation worked to erase all these beautiful landmarks and turn the city into a pile of rubble.

Our life wasn't very exciting, it was ordinary, but even that ordinary life has now become a dream.

Life has become a piece of hell. We have forgotten the meaning of safety. Bombing is everywhere. The occupation has killed many of my relatives, friends and members of my camp. In addition to this hell, the high prices have become unbearable, and we can barely afford our basic needs for basic materials.


I work with the UNRWA as an Administrative Assistant. I've been working from the beginning of the war to help the displaced people in Rafah city . My work is in the flour distribution for my society.

The occupation targeted the main UNRWA Warehouse while I was working there. I sustained moderate injuries while my colleague who was standing with me a few meters away from the site of the attack was martyred. I currently can't walk on my left foot due to the penetration of many shrapnel into it, and I am now trying to recover.'
